Tony is probably the most hittable fighter on the roster. He either just doesn't care or has the same stand up coach as Rockhold.Poirier would probably land good shots early, but wilt late. The difference between Tony and Max is that while both are attrition fighters, Tony is bigger and does more damage. Tony also has the grappling threat (probably not through traditional TD's but through his unorthodox way he forces scrambles, his front headlock, etc.).
I will say that I give Dustin a better chance vs Tony after seeing how composed he was vs Max's pressure. I just think the difference is that he could walk through whatever Max landed. Tony may not have huge one-shot KO power, but he does more damage than Max. People talked about how damaged that Ortega was after fighting Max, but that's EVERYONE that fights Tony.
